38.13.29 CxMASKy

CAN Mask y Register
Note:
  1. The individual bytes in this multibyte register can be accessed with the following register names:
    • CxMASKyT: Accesses the top byte MASKy[31:24]
    • CxMASKyU: Accesses the upper byte MASKy[23:16]
    • CxMASKyH: Accesses the high byte MASKy[15:8]
    • CxMASKyL: Accesses the low byte MASKy[7:0]
  2. Each Mask is associated with a filter,[y] denotes Filter number, from 0 to 11.
Name: CxMASKy
Offset: 0x00

Bit 30 – MIDE Identifier Receive Mode

ValueDescription
1 Matches only message types (standard or extended address) that correspond to the EXIDE bit of in the filter
0 Matches either standard or extended address message if filters match (i.e., if (Filter SID) = (Message SID) or if (Filter SID/EID) = (Message SID/EID))

Bits 28:11 – MEID[17:0] Extended Identifier Mask

In DeviceNet mode, these are the mask bits for the first two data bytes

Bits 10:0 – MSID[10:0] Standard Identifier Mask
